Pros

Peers are good-hearted people. Somewhat flexible work schedule. Provides exceptional equipment and tools for employees.

Cons

Amateur executive management. Follows a management resource textbook because the executive team lacks overall experience. Demonstrated lack of care for overall employee well-being or growth. Dishonest management tactics, including deceptive communication to clients. All employees, except for the lucky ones in sales, are subject to extreme scrutiny including minor or mundane infractions. Interdepartmental politics and favoritism. A misleading attitude toward employees' work performance by management. An employee may follow the incorrect instructions for a long time without proper correction, only to be arbitrarily punished by management at any given moment. General lack of communication and transparency by upper management. Human resources does not work in best interest of employees and may even work to have an employee terminated without just cause. CEO projects that company will have vast growth without providing anything of substance to back this up.
